Job opening: ADMINISTRATIVE SUPPORT ASSISTANT(OA)

Salary: $55 236 - 71 808 per year
Published at: Jun 05 2024
Employment Type: Full-time
Click on "Learn more about this agency" button below to view Eligibilities being considered and other IMPORTANT information. The primary purpose of this position is: to manage the administrative programs and processes of the organization and serve as a liaison with force support/manpower/personnel offices and key program managers; additionally trains traditional reservists in all tasks of the position.

Duties

Manages execution of Publications and Forms Programs and all By-Law Programs. Performs work regarding planning and organizing all administrative activities and processes for the organization. Performs other clerical and administrative work in support of the office/organization. Manages, prepares and maintains documentation concerning the administrative orders program. Monitors and directs the control of incoming and outgoing correspondence. Serves as the resident subject matter expert for all mandated administrative support programs. Integrates a variety of software to produce final products.

Qualifications

In order to qualify, you must meet the specialized experience requirements described in the Office of Personnel Management (OPM) Qualification Standards for General Schedule Positions, Clerical and Administrative Support Positions. SPECIALIZED EXPERIENCE: Applicants must have at least one year of specialized experience equivalent to the GS-06 grade level in the Federal service serving as the primary point of contact for all administrative support programs such defense travel system, drug demand reduction, health care, fitness, purchase card, safety, security, supply, civilian timecard and unit recognition programs; overall administrative and activity room operations; evaluating program efficiency to implement processes to improve programs; assessing manpower authorizations and utilization; ensuring all actions are accomplished and if problems exist, identify other alternatives as needed; independently noting and following-up on commitments made at meetings/conferences; using correct grammar, spelling, punctuation, capitalization, and format to prepare and edit written correspondences and reports; using office automation to produce a wide range of documents that often require complex formats, such as graphics or tables within text, to edit and reformat electronic drafts, and to update and revise existing databases or spreadsheets. OR EDUCATION: Successfully completed 1 year of graduated education that is directly related to the work of the position. 18 semester hours or 27 quarter hours should be considered as satisfying the 1 year of full-time study requirement. NOTE: You must submit a copy of transcripts. OR COMBINATION OF EXPERIENCE AND EDUCATION: A combination of education and experience may be used to qualify for this position as long as the computed percentage of the requirements is at least 100%. NOTE: You must submit a copy of transcripts. FEDERAL TIME-IN-GRADE (TIG) REQUIREMENT FOR GENERAL SCHEDULE (GS) POSITIONS: Merit promotion applicants must meet applicable time-in-grade requirements to be considered eligible. One year at the GS-06 level is required to meet the time-in-grade requirements for the GS-07 level. TIG applies if you are in a current GS position or held a GS position within the previous 52 weeks. NOTE: Applicants applying as VEOA candidates who are current GS civil service employees or are prior GS civil service employees within the past 52 weeks must also meet time-in-grade requirements. Education

As a general rule, education is not creditable above GS-5 for most positions covered by this standard; however, graduate education may be credited in those few instances where the graduate education is directly related to the work of the position.

IF USING EDUCATION TO QUALIFY: If position has a positive degree requirement or education forms the basis for qualifications, you MUST submit transcriptswith the application. Official transcripts are not required at the time of application; however, if position has a positive degree requirement, qualifying based on education alone or in combination with experience, transcripts must be verified prior to appointment. An accrediting institution recognized by the U.S. Department of Education must accredit education. Click here to check accreditation.

FOREIGN EDUCATION: Education completed in foreign colleges or universities may be used to meet the requirements. You must show proof the education credentials have been deemed to be at least equivalent to that gained in conventional U.S. education program. It is your responsibility to provide such evidence when applying.
